Great FPS(Review From Amazon) | General Comments: This is one of the best First Person Shooters out there for the PSP. The controls are a bit complicated at first, but once you get the hang of it, they offer a wide selection of commands and controls. The missions are fun and have different levels of difficulty for beginners. The only complaint I would have with this game is as others have said, it all takes place in the same country and the terrain gets a bit tiresome, but not enough to make the game less fun. |

Great game and weapons.(Review From Amazon) | General Comments: In this game you are a U.S. Navy Seal, the most lethal fighting force in the world. As a seal (SEa Air Land) you work in two man fireteams and are forced to go through a variety of elements. Camoflouged and equiped with real-world weapons. Your arsenal includes assault riffles such as the M16, M4, XM8, SFCR LW and HW, and AK-47 as well as many other types of weapons and explosives. The missions can prove to be difficult and you must learn to use team commands and be extremely stealth. You have your choice of partners, Wrath a master of stealth, Bronco a close range fighter, and Lonestar a sharpshooter. The infacture mode is good but it does have a slight tendancy to freeze. Overall this is a great game combining shooting and stealth, a must-buy for all PSP owners! |
